Ballina 3+1+1 Electric Recliner Package β Full Product Details
\nThe 3+1+1 layout answers a specific question for an electric recliner setup: do you want a second lounge, or two individual armchairs? Single chairs can be angled, separated, and placed where a second lounge can't β which makes the 3+1+1 a flexible alternative to the more conventional 3+2. The Ballina 3+1+1 Electric Recliner Package delivers that with the Ballina 3 Seater and two Ballina Single Electric Recliners in matching grey nappa-look fabric β five seats, four dual-motor recliners, and the 3-Seater's drop-down power console.
\nEvery reclining seat across the three pieces uses the same dual-motor electric mechanism: one motor for the recline angle, one for the powered headrest, each controlled independently. That gives finer adjustment than a single-motor recliner β a deep body recline with the head forward to read, or both matched for a movie. The 3-Seater reclines on its two end seats, with the fixed middle folding down into a power console that holds an electric outlet, wireless charging, and an LED reading light. The two singles focus on the core recline experience, and across all three pieces you also get LED-illuminated cup holders and hidden storage compartments built into the armrests.
\nAll three pieces are upholstered in soft-touch grey nappa-look fabric over a hardwood and engineered-wood frame with high-density foam fill, and each runs on mains power β a mains lead is required and there's no battery backup, so plan a power point near each piece. If you'd prefer a second lounge with a built-in fridge instead of two single armchairs, the alternative is the Ballina 3+2 package built around the Ballina 2 Seater Electric Recliner Lounge. Wipe Down Weekly
Run a slightly damp microfibre cloth over all three pieces weekly. Skip harsh detergents, solvents, and abrasive cloths β they can damage the nappa-look finish.
Blot Spills Straight Away
Address spills immediately with a clean dry cloth, blotting outward rather than rubbing. Liquids left to sit can affect the finish over time.
Cycle the Mechanisms
Run each recline and powered headrest through its full range once a month β across all four reclining seats β to keep the motors and tracks moving smoothly.
Keep Out of Direct Sun
Sustained UV fades and dries the nappa-look upholstery. Position the pieces away from direct afternoon sun, especially in north-facing rooms.

How does the dual-motor recline work?
Each reclining seat across all three pieces has two independent motors. One drives the recline angle from upright to fully reclined; the other adjusts the headrest position. Because they're controlled separately, you can set the body angle and head support independently β head forward and body reclined for reading, or both matched for watching TV.
What happens during a power outage?
All three pieces run on mains power with no battery backup. If the power cuts out while a seat is reclined, it will stay reclined until power returns, so we recommend leaving seats upright when they're not in use. Each piece needs to be within reach of mains power β worth keeping in mind when placing the two single armchairs around the room.
